What is SYZ?
SYZ is the official Indian Railways station code assigned to Sonagir Railway Station, located in the Datia district of Madhya Pradesh, India. The station falls under the administrative jurisdiction of the Jhansi Railway Division, which is part of the broader North Central Railway zone. Sonagir is a small but culturally rich town with deep historical and religious importance, particularly known for its magnificent cluster of Jain temples situated on a hill called Siddhachal. These temples attract thousands of Jain pilgrims and tourists from across the country every year, especially during the annual Mahavirji fair held in the region. The three-letter code SYZ plays a vital role in uniquely identifying this station across the vast Indian Railways network, helping passengers check train schedules, book tickets through the IRCTC platform, and track their journey status in real time. Trains passing through or halting at SYZ typically connect Sonagir to nearby major cities like Jhansi, Gwalior, Datia, and other key destinations in central India.
